Description
A Manual of the Art of Fiction by Clayton Meeker Hamilton is a seminal guide that delves into the intricate craft of storytelling. Written in the early 20th century, Hamilton combines practical advice with theoretical insights, making it a valuable resource for aspiring writers and literature enthusiasts alike. The book covers fundamental elements of fiction, such as character development, plot construction, and narrative voice, while also addressing broader themes of creativity and inspiration. Hamilton’s eloquent prose and structured approach make complex ideas accessible, encouraging writers to hone their skills and cultivate their unique voices. Through a blend of instruction and analysis, Hamilton offers timeless wisdom on the nuances of fiction writing, emphasizing the importance of observation, empathy, and revision. This manual remains relevant today, serving as a cherished reference for anyone looking to understand the art of fiction and improve their literary craft.
